Product Overview: HEF4001BP
The HEF4001BP is a high-quality integrated circuit (IC) from NXP Semiconductors, designed to deliver reliable performance in a wide range of electronic applications. This IC is a part of the HEF4000 family, which is well-known for its robustness and versatility in the field of digital electronics.
Key Features
- Logic Type: The HEF4001BP is a Quad 2-input NOR gate. This fundamental logic gate is essential in digital circuits, providing the logical NOR operation, which is the inverted output of an OR gate.
- Package: It comes in a DIP (Dual In-line Package) with 14 pins, which is a standard through-hole package, making it suitable for breadboard prototyping as well as permanent PCB installations.
- Voltage Range: The device operates within a wide voltage range, typically from 3V to 15V, allowing for flexibility in various power environments.
- Temperature Range: With a broad operating temperature range, the HEF4001BP can function in diverse conditions, making it a reliable choice for industrial and consumer applications.
